    Saturday 4th September 2021, First Saturday in September, the Memorial of the Blessed Virgin Mary. Why is Saturday dedicated to honoring the Blessed Virgin Mary?
    This is an ancient custom dating back to the time of Emperor Charlemagne in the 800s. Some date the custom earlier than Charlemagne.

    Most great medieval Doctors of the Church endorsed the practice, viz:
    Saints Bernardine of Sienna, Thomas Aquinas, Bernard of Clairvaux and Bonaventure.

    One interesting reason for this practice:

    After the Crucifixion on Friday, everyone had lost faith in Jesus and went home. On Saturday, Mary continued the Vigil alone waiting for the Resurrection of her Son. Tradition believed that Jesus appeared to His mother first after the Resurrection. Not surprising!

    Friday 3rd September 2021, 22nd Week in Ordinary Time is the First Friday in September. We honor the Sacred Heart of Jesus on the First Friday of every month.

    Today is also the feast of the Servant of the Servants of God, St Gregory the Great. (540 - 604). Pope and Doctor of the Church.  When God chose and anointed David, He exclaimed with delight: "I have chosen David, my servant; with my holy oil I have anointed him. My hand will be with him; my arm will make him strong." (Psalm 89: 21 - 22). This Scripture can be applied to Pope Gregory the Great. Gregory was the David of his days. 7

    St. Gregory the Great was called from the City Hall where he was the Mayor of Rome to be fisher of men. He left everything and followed Jesus.
    He used his wealth to found six monasteries before he was elected Pope. He is noted in history for instituting liturgical reforms and initiating missionary endeavors. It was due to St Gregory that missionaries were first sent to England.

    "Meditate daily on the words of your Creator.  Learn the Heart of God in the words of God, that your soul may be enkindled with greater longing for heavenly joys." One of the many wise sayings of St Gregory the Great.

    The Gospel of today deals with fasting. Fasting, Prayer and Almsgiving are the 3 pillars of Christian spiritual life.
    Do you fast? How often? What do you fast from?

    On the three pillars of the spiritual life, the Church teaches:
    CCC 1434: "The interior penance of the Christian can be expressed in many and various ways. Scripture and the Fathers insist above all on three forms, fasting, prayer, and almsgiving, which express conversion in relation to oneself, to God, and to others. Alongside the radical purification bought about by Baptism or martyrdom they cite as means of obtaining forgiveness of sins: efforts at reconciliation with one’s neighbor, tears of repentance, concern for the salvation of one’s neighbor, the intercession of the saints, and the practice of charity “which covers a multitude of sins.”

    Some Christians abstain from meat and alcohol on Friday and Wednesday. Others abstain also from television, movies and gambling.
